Overexpression of insulin-like growth factor-2 mRNA-binding protein 1 is associated with periodontal disease
Objective: To investigate the potential role of a novel m6A RNA regulator, Insulin-like Growth Factor-2 mRNA-binding protein 1 (IGF2BP1), in periodontal disease pathogenesis.
